BoardRenderMetrics (DEBUG-only, the pathfinder's counter bag plus a strip-body discriminator that tells a failed gate from a direct Observation invalidation) counted at BoardView/LaneView/CardFaceView/ TrashLaneView bodies and MasonryLayout's callbacks. DragSignposts wraps dropUpdated, retargetCards, commitDrop, and the commit-to-covering- snapshot release pause; input latency reports honestly against NSApp.currentEvent's mach base or labels itself base=none — no event timestamp rides the drop path. BoardRenderPerformanceTests hosts the real BoardView off-screen: a value-equal reload runs zero lane and zero card bodies, a one-card edit repaints one card of 180. The lane-body budget is <= laneCount with the headerInk chain documented and a two-way tripwire that fails when the fix lands. Methodology in RENDER-INSTRUMENTATION.md. import SwiftUI
|
|
|
|
#if DEBUG
|
|
/// **Render-cost counters for the board strip — DEBUG only, and the only way a test can tell "one
|
|
/// card repainted" from "the whole board rebuilt".**
|
|
///
|
|
/// Ported from the pathfinder (`Kanban/Views/MasonryLayout.swift`'s `BoardRenderMetrics`), which is
|
|
/// where the shape comes from: a flat bag of counters, a `reset()`, and one `count…` call at the top
|
|
/// of each body being watched. What is new here is the masonry's **column** vocabulary and the
|
|
/// trash column's own counter — Lanework's strip has three body levels, not two.
|
|
///
|
|
/// ### What it is for
|
|
///
|
|
/// The 2026-07-31 drag-performance work shipped four gates — `LaneView.==` / `CardFaceView.==`
|
|
/// applied through `.equatable()` (84f909a), the resting-layout cache (a51ad75), the marquee's
|
|
/// de-observation (f6105d4) and the resize hold (409f430) — and every one of them is a claim about
|
|
/// *how many bodies run*. A claim like that is unfalsifiable from the outside: the board looks the
|
|
/// same either way, only the frame rate differs, and a frame rate is a machine fact rather than a
|
|
/// test. These counters are what turn each gate into an assertion (`BoardRenderPerformanceTests`).
|
|
///
|
|
/// The reading half is RENDER-INSTRUMENTATION.md at the repo root, beside DRAG-REORDER.md: the
|
|
/// Instruments 26 SwiftUI template, the Hitches thresholds, and how the drag signposts
|
|
/// (`DragSignposts`) line up against these numbers.
|
|
///
|
|
/// ### Why the storage is what it is
|
|
///
|
|
/// `nonisolated(unsafe) static var`, exactly as the pathfinder has it. In practice every write
|
|
/// happens on the main actor — SwiftUI runs body evaluation *and* `Layout` callbacks there — but the
|
|
/// `Layout` conformance itself is `nonisolated`, so a main-actor-isolated counter would not be
|
|
/// reachable from `MasonryLayout.sizeThatFits`. The unsafety is real and deliberately accepted: this
|
|
/// type does not exist in a release build, and the alternative is a lock on the layout hot path of a
|
|
/// board the whole point is to keep fast.
|
|
///
|
|
/// **Nothing in the app reads these.** They are written by the bodies below and read by tests. A
|
|
/// counter that branched would be instrumentation that changed the thing it measures.
|
|
enum BoardRenderMetrics {
|
|
|
|
/// Every `subview.sizeThatFits(…)` `MasonryLayout` actually performed — the number its
|
|
/// measurement cache exists to drive down.
|
|
nonisolated(unsafe) static var masonryMeasurements = 0
|
|
|
|
/// Measurement requests served from that cache instead.
|
|
nonisolated(unsafe) static var masonryCacheHits = 0
|
|
|
|
/// `MasonryLayout.sizeThatFits` calls — SwiftUI probes a layout more than once per pass, which
|
|
/// is the multiplier the cache absorbs.
|
|
nonisolated(unsafe) static var masonrySizeThatFitsCalls = 0
|
|
|
|
/// `MasonryLayout.placeSubviews` calls.
|
|
nonisolated(unsafe) static var masonryPlaceCalls = 0
|
|
|
|
/// `CardFaceView.body` evaluations — both homes, board and trash, since it is one view.
|
|
nonisolated(unsafe) static var cardBodyEvaluations = 0
|
|
|
|
/// `BoardView.body` evaluations — the strip itself.
|
|
///
|
|
/// Not one of the pathfinder's counters, and it earns its place by being the **discriminator**:
|
|
/// "a lane re-ran" means one of two completely different things depending on whether the strip
|
|
/// re-ran with it. Strip **and** lanes is a parent pass whose `.equatable()` gate did not
|
|
/// suppress; lanes with the strip *still* is a direct Observation invalidation, which no gate has
|
|
/// any say over (`LaneView.==`'s own note). Without this number the two are indistinguishable
|
|
/// from a test, and the first diagnosis this instrumentation produced turned on exactly that
|
|
/// distinction (RENDER-INSTRUMENTATION.md ▸ What the first run found).
|
|
nonisolated(unsafe) static var stripBodyEvaluations = 0
|
|
|
|
/// `LaneView.body` evaluations (the pathfinder's `columnBodyEvaluations`, renamed to Lanework's
|
|
/// vocabulary: a lane is the kanban column, and a *column* is an interior masonry track).
|
|
nonisolated(unsafe) static var laneBodyEvaluations = 0
|
|
|
|
/// `TrashLaneView.body` evaluations — counted separately from the lanes because the column is
|
|
/// not one: it renders only while shown, and it re-runs for reasons the lanes do not have.
|
|
nonisolated(unsafe) static var trashLaneBodyEvaluations = 0
|
|
|
|
/// Every container body the strip draws — what "≤ N container bodies" is asserted against, so a
|
|
/// regression cannot hide by moving from one counter to the other.
|
|
static var containerBodyEvaluations: Int {
|
|
laneBodyEvaluations + trashLaneBodyEvaluations
|
|
}
|
|
|
|
static func reset() {
|
|
masonryMeasurements = 0
|
|
masonryCacheHits = 0
|
|
masonrySizeThatFitsCalls = 0
|
|
masonryPlaceCalls = 0
|
|
cardBodyEvaluations = 0
|
|
stripBodyEvaluations = 0
|
|
laneBodyEvaluations = 0
|
|
trashLaneBodyEvaluations = 0
|
|
}
|
|
|
|
static func countStripBody() { stripBodyEvaluations += 1 }
|
|
static func countCardBody() { cardBodyEvaluations += 1 }
|
|
static func countLaneBody() { laneBodyEvaluations += 1 }
|
|
static func countTrashLaneBody() { trashLaneBodyEvaluations += 1 }
|
|
}
|
|
#endif
